With the news that GT6 is under-development, I took a look at the rival 'Forza' series to see their next advancement in the francise. With a quick search on Google I came across 'Forza Horizon'.
It seemed 'Turn 10' had based a totally new concept of open-world racing; similar to TDU. Leaving the track for the road. In the trailer featured at E3, it included Off-road rally based races, drift and 'street racing'; similar to many NFS games. It also featured an autoshow, which could emphasies more visual tuning to the vast array of cars featured in the trailer.
In my opinion, 'Turn 10' are combining TDU (open-world racing) and NFS (Drift, Street Racing, Autoshow) into 1 game. If it all works, it should be great to see the outcome.
